## Changelog — Ticktrace 1.9

### Renamed: DRIFT_API_TOKEN
During the cron drift investigation we found plugins confusing this variable with the metrics token, so it has been renamed to indicate it authorizes drift-report uploads specifically. Plugin authors must read the new name from 1.9 onward; the old name is ignored without warning. Sample env files in the SDK are updated. In your deployment env file, the drift-report upload secret is set on the next line.

env line for fawef-taguf: VAULT_KEY13=a9695905a9a90

## Authentication

The Bramblewick catalogue importer requires a bearer token for all write operations against the staging catalogue. Read-only browsing of MARC records does not require authentication. Tokens are scoped to a single import batch and expire after 24 hours, so request a fresh one per run. Pass the token in the Authorization header of every request. For local development against the sandbox catalogue, use the token below.

bearer token for tawig-bahif: eyJhbGciOiJIUzI1NiIsInR5cCI6IkpXVCJ9.eyJzdWIiOiIo-yiO33jvEIn0.T9qLInSAqhTN

Subject: Brimhash cut-over complete

Hi all — the bloom filter now fronts the Kestrelstore key-value tier in production as of last night. False-positive rate is holding at 0.4%, and read traffic to the backing store dropped 62%. No auth paths changed; the filter is read-only and rebuilt hourly. For your review, the active configuration values are included below.

service settings:
[silwyn]
host = silwyn.crelvogrid.internal
user = silwyn_svc
database = silwyn_prod